The United Kingdom is home to the British Royal Family, one of the most famous and well-known royal families in the world. The Queen and her family reside in London, the capital city of the UK. Buckingham Palace, the official residence of the Queen, is a popular tourist attraction and serves as the administrative headquarters of the British Royal Family. London, with its rich history and iconic landmarks, provides an ideal backdrop for the British monarchy to carry out their duties and host numerous events.

In France, the royal family of the past, the Bourbon dynasty, once lived in the magnificent city of Versailles. Although the monarchy was abolished in 1792, the city remains a symbol of French grandeur and opulence. Today, the Palace of Versailles is a UNESCO World Heritage site, attracting millions of visitors each year. The city of Versailles is located near Paris, which is also the current capital of France.

Russia’s Romanov dynasty, which was overthrown in the Russian Revolution of 1917, had its royal family living in St. Petersburg. This city, once known as Petrograd and Leningrad, is known for its stunning architecture and rich cultural heritage. The Hermitage Museum, located in the Winter Palace, is one of the world’s largest and most famous museums. Although the Romanovs no longer rule, St. Petersburg continues to be a popular destination for tourists interested in Russian history.

In Asia, the Japanese Imperial Family resides in Tokyo, the capital city of Japan. The Imperial Palace, located in the heart of Tokyo, is the official residence of the Emperor of Japan. Tokyo is a vibrant city with a rich cultural heritage, known for its technological advancements, culinary delights, and stunning cherry blossoms in spring.
